I love offering this accommodation to guests who appreciate all it has to offer. It has been available on various sites since 2004 and gradually improved over the years.
Why they chose this property
2 NIGHT STAYS: There is a fee of 15% of the total vrbo charge, and payable in cash on arrival. Previously, the minimum stay was 3 nights. Please Vrbo have no facility to charge extra for 2 night stays.
Possible to sleep 4, but maximum adults-only recommended is 3.
Accommodation:-
1) Good-sized bathroom (7' 9" square = 2.35 metres),
2) Medium sized bed-sitting room with picture windows (12' x 10' 4" = 3.68 x 3.15 metres),
3) Small/medium-sized (see pictures) living/dining room with kitchenette (13' 1" x 8' = 4.0 x 2.44 metres)
Alcoved cooking area. Sofabed opening into double or a king-size bed if 2 bedrooms are needed.
If you are considering 4 people, make sure you would be happy with Baby Belling cooker (2 hotplates, grill and oven) plus microwave
Bed-sitting room:- Double bed plus, futon single sofa bed which is 3’ 3” (1 metre) wide with 2 inch thick soft wool topper
Living/Dining room: King size or double sofa bed, or use as a shortish single (5’ 3” or 1.60 metres) without extending, or 2 singles using the extra, very comfortable, self-inflating air bed on legs.
Using 2 singles, or sofa bed extended to a double, will mean folding down the drop leaf table and quite restricted floor space.
POSSIBLE DISADVANTAGES (Continued from main description)
One side of the double bed is against a wall so the person sleeping that side would need to get out of the bed from bottom of the bed to avoid disturbing the other.
Wi Fi affects my health, but is offered providing you do switch it off whenever not in use, or you leave the house, and also off overnight.
The exterior of the bungalow is due for re-painting.

What makes this property unique
NOT "Unique Benefits" here, but CHILDREN RULES:
Most children love it here, but you may consider the woodland not suitable because you don’t want to be “keeping watch” or telling them what NOT to do…
Children under 16 must be in your sight, or within 50 metres at all times.
The 5 POOLS ARE DANGEROUS FOR CHILDREN because of the very deep mud.
So paddling only is allowed in 1 of the pools and the stream that feeds it.
Climbing on, or crawling under the safety fences at the edges of pools is prohibited.
Climbing of trees or clambering on fallen ones is not allowed.
Throwing of sticks and stones is not allowed
Ball games or frisbee are not allowed
Behind the caravan is out of bounds because of mains electric supply.
Children must not move:-
· Several ropes or branches deliberately placed on the ground and painted white, which means “do not cross here in very windy weather. Risk of falling branches.”
Curved branches laid on the ground as “path markers”. They are difficult to replace as they are just the right shape and length for their job
· Wire netting covering the drainage pipes from the pools and which prevent un-removable blockage by sticks etc.
· Stones, especially large stones at the edges of the pools
· Signs mounted (not very securely) on top of stakes in the ground, and notifying any exclusive areas, paths which are only for the sure-footed etc.
· Benches. These are in very specific positions, often with levelling stones under one or more feet.
Branches woven into the top of the garden fence, which prevent sheep jumping over
What CAN children do?
· Enjoy the hammock, swinging benches and hanging chair
· Running and hide and seek or treasure hunt games
· Use nets and glass jars provided to hunt for tadpoles and newts in the mud of the pools
· Use branches only from the many stacked up wood piles to make anything
Enjoy preparing food in the fire pit or chiminea
